Transaction aef786c94bcf041024f71318e66edf04a8cf857c6e3559b77db52e03beefca10
1 Input
1 Output
-
aef786c94bcf041024f71318e66edf04a8cf857c6e3559b77db52e03beefca10:0
- value
- 2101637
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 63d54fd2aebc3c675df3654dd69108e02da66741 OP_EQUAL
- address
- 3AntMhWYLVaQ9W5NPM6tjK6MMofbsZM1ny